The allure of Shanghai beauties is deeply rooted in the city's historical evolution. In the early 20th century, Shanghai was known as the "Paris of the East," a cosmopolitan hub where Eastern and Western cultures converged. This unique cultural fusion gave rise to a new standard of beauty that combined traditional Chinese aesthetics with Western elegance. The Shanghai beauties of this era were often seen as the epitome of this cultural synthesis, embodying both the grace of traditional Chinese women and the confidence of modern, independent women.
One of the most striking aspects of Shanghai beauties is their fashion sense. The city has always been a trendsetter in fashion, and its women have been at the forefront of style. From the qipao, a traditional Chinese dress that was modernized in Shanghai, to the latest Western couture, Shanghai beauties have always known how to make a statement. The qipao, for example, was transformed in Shanghai from a simple garment into a symbol of elegance and sophistication. Designers in the city added intricate embroidery, bold colors, and Western-style collars and sleeves, creating a unique blend of East and West that became synonymous with Shanghai beauty.

In the early 20th century, Shanghai was a melting pot of different cultures, and its women were exposed to new ideas and lifestyles. Many of them were educated in Western schools and universities, which instilled in them a sense of independence and confidence. This new breed of women, known as "modern girls," rejected traditional gender roles and embraced a more liberated way of life. They smoked, drank, and socialized freely, often defying the expectations of their conservative families and society.
